freedreno: Fix derivatives without texturing on a3xx-a5xx.
authorEric Anholt <eric@anholt.net>
Wed, 22 Apr 2020 18:48:44 +0000 (11:48 -0700)
committerMarge Bot <eric+marge@anholt.net>
Mon, 27 Apr 2020 19:06:57 +0000 (19:06 +0000)
commitb34ee185f44c6d473e4e343d1e9f406a25dae67f
tree4d2c623cf0ca476eb5cdef8f29302e5f9819b850
parentfa49a5032f33802fc136ba7095edaf06df1efa33
freedreno: Fix derivatives without texturing on a3xx-a5xx.

The shader variant tells us if we should set the PIXLODENABLE flag.

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/4685>
.gitlab-ci/deqp-freedreno-a307-fails.txt
.gitlab-ci/deqp-freedreno-a530-fails.txt
src/gallium/drivers/freedreno/a3xx/fd3_program.c
src/gallium/drivers/freedreno/a4xx/fd4_program.c
src/gallium/drivers/freedreno/a5xx/fd5_program.c